Those blue shells are a bit shit (the Windjammers one, not NG Dev's blue shells). They dont fit properly and the screws frequently break off.
The blue ones were designed by Yaton and manufactured in China originally for the Chinese market. Once he started exporting those carts en mass, the blue carts could then be found all over the place. TBH they aren't terrible - the fit is decent enough and they are very similar to the originals. I've seen a number of other black/clear cases on bootlegs with matte finishes that are absolute trash.
